Margaret and Olwen Lloyd George at No 11 Downing Street
Description
David Lloyd George was appointed Chancellor of the Exchequer in April 1908 by the Liberal Prime Minister Herbert Asquith. This provided him with the opportunity to put in place many of the reforms he wished to see his government fulfil.
